针对电站管道带台阶不规则接头的相控阵超声检测时,存在声束传播复杂、工艺设计和信号源分析困难等问题,首先建立了相控阵声束在管道不规则接头中的传播模型;其次利用该模型计算和分析了典型斜台结构对声束的遮挡、探头最佳入射点、内斜台产生反射声束的偏转方向等影响;最后利用该模型对现场管道三通与弯头处不规则接头相控阵超声检测工艺及结果进行辅助分析。结果表明:所提出的声线分析模型可以准确评估内外斜台对声束传播造成的影响,预测结构回波,为相控阵超声检测管道不规则接头的工艺和信号分析提供了重要的依据。

The phased array ultrasonic test of the irregular structures of welds with the tilt parts in power plant is difficult because of the complexity on the procedure design and signal analysis.Firstly,the acoustic line model for the propagation of phased array ultrasonic filed in the weld of irregular structures is established based on Snell law. Secondly,the model is used to calculate and analyze the influence of the tilt parts on the shielding beams,incident points,reflection beams.Finally,the model was applied to analyze the ultrasonic phased array testing process and the results of the in-situ irregular structures of welded joint at the tee bend and elbow.The results indicate that the established model provide an efficient tool for the procedure design and signal analysis of the phased array ultrasonic testing of the irregular structures of welds.
